This article forecasts every one of the first-round selections for the upcoming 2025 MLB Draft, focusing on top prospects like Kade Anderson from LSU and Ethan Holliday.

The 2025 MLB Draft is set to kick off on Sunday night, coinciding with the All-Star festivities held in Atlanta. This is the first draft to take place during the All-Star break after MLB shifted the schedule four years ago to enhance its marketing potential, a decision that has stirred mixed feelings among executives.

With a total of 27 first-round selections predicted, the Washington Nationals are expected to make a noteworthy pick at No. 1, even after a recent front office shake-up. Kade Anderson from LSU is leading the speculation as the top choice, backed by his impressive performance and potential upside. In contrast, the Rockies seem poised to select Ethan Holliday, the son of former MLB star Matt Holliday.

Key Draft Insights

  • The Nationals are predicted to choose LHP Kade Anderson.
  • The Rockies are expected to snag IF Ethan Holliday with the fourth pick.

The selection process is influenced by a lottery system introduced to determine the order of picks, departing from the traditional inverse standings format.
